By understanding the distance between the sender and receiver, the pulse speed can be established. The variety of analyses need to be high adequate to offer reasonably accurate outcomes. The minimum number of rebound hammer readings is 15; as stated earlier, a lot more readings are advised to attain an extra accurate outcome. The tool calibration is needed to be done periodically, as the spring inside the rebound hammer sheds some of its rigidity with age.

A concrete joint is a purposeful break or division in a concrete framework, developed to regulate the location and level of breaking that occurs as concrete remedies and reduces. These joints are important in ensuring that the concrete can increase, agreement, and move without creating architectural damage.

A tremie is a vertical, or near-vertical, pipe with a hopper at the top made use of to put concrete underwater in a way that prevents washout of cement from the mix because of unstable water call with the concrete while it is moving. The toggle bag approach is generally used for positioning small amounts and for fixings.
